
Many things go into mattress selection. The mattress’s spring unit is crucial. Popular is the LFK spring unit.
The LFK spring unit, commonly known as the “K-Series” spring unit, is a pocketed coil system that provides unique support and comfort. The springs are individually encased in compartments to isolate motion and eliminate sleeping partner disruptions. Without your partner’s motions, you can sleep better.
Due to its high coil count and unique construction, the LFK spring unit provides great support. Each spring responds individually to your body weight and pressure, delivering personalized support where you need it most. It can relieve pressure points and pain while you sleep.
Durability is another virtue of the LFK spring unit. The mattress’s high coil count and individual pocket design avoid sagging. You can enjoy a soft and supportive sleeping surface for years.

Mattress makers benefit from the LFK spring unit’s sleep quality and comfort benefits. Mattresses with variable firmness and support levels can be made with the pocketed coil design.
Easy assembly is another feature of the LFK spring unit. Unlike typical coil systems, the LFK spring unit has preassembled sections that may be readily joined to make a mattress. This speeds up and streamlines manufacturing, lowering costs for businesses and customers.
Adjustable beds work with the LFK spring unit. Because each spring acts separately, it can readily conform to the contour of an adjustable bed frame, giving personalized support as the bed is adjusted.
Like with every mattress component, the LFK spring unit has several downsides. As the coils move, they can make a squeaking sound. However, proper construction and high-quality materials can frequently mitigate this.
Mattresses with LFK spring units may cost more than those with standard spring systems. Nonetheless, many people think that the LFK spring unit’s benefits are worth the investment in a high-quality mattress.

The LFK spring unit is only one thing to consider when buying a mattress. The mattress’s comfort and support can also be affected by its upper layers’ foam or padding.
For instance, memory foam contours to your body and appropriately distributes weight, which might help folks with back discomfort or other ailments. Memory foam can retain heat, making some people uncomfortable at night.
Nonetheless, latex foam is hypoallergenic, durable, and breathable. It’s also more responsive than memory foam, which some people like.

It’s also worth mentioning that the LFK spring unit can be found in innerspring, hybrid, and even some foam mattresses with coils for support. This makes it a viable alternative for individuals who want support and durability without sacrificing comfort.
Many mattress manufacturers provide LFK spring units with more coils or different coil gauges to suit different sleep preferences. Some like a harder surface, while others like a fluffy one.
Consider the coil size and weight when buying a mattress with an LFK spring unit. Bigger, thicker coils may provide additional support and durability, but they also make the mattress heavier and harder to shift. Smaller, thinner coils may feel softer but may not support as well over time.
